The effect of Harderian adenectomy on the antibody response in chickens   总被引:2,自引:0,他引:2  
Intact chicks and those that had their glands of Harder (GH) removed (GHx) at 1 day of age were studied for their response to optically or intraperitoneally (IP) applied antigens. Following exposure of the chicks to sheep red blood cells (SRBCs), killed Brucella abortus, or bovine serum albumin (BSA), serum and tear samples were collected and assayed for antibodies. Of the two sources of antibodies, the serum generally had higher levels than did the tears. The only exception to this occurred in the intact chicks inoculated by the eye, in which serum and tear levels were equivalent. With SRBCs, no difference could be detected between the two routes of inoculation. However, IP inoculation produced higher levels of antibody in the serum of intact and GHx chicks inoculated with B. abortus or BSA and in the tears of the GHx chicks exposed to B. abortus. Removal of the GH resulted in a consistent decrease in antibody levels in the tears, regardless of the route of exposure. Although this effect was noted with all three antigens, it was more pronounced in the trials using B. abortus and BSA. This finding is discussed in terms of describing the importance of the GH as a source of antibodies to optically applied antigens, and its importance as a route of circulating antibody egress. Furthermore, the feasibility of using the antibody response in tears to a test antigen is discussed as a means of measuring the immune status of a functioning GH.  相似文献

Chicks which had been inoculated with infectious bursal disease virus (IBDV) at 1 day of age had a severe depression of bursa-dependent humoral immune functions by day 42. Antibody responses against rabbit red blood cells or to immunization with bovine serum albumin were significantly suppressed. In contrast, chicks inoculated with IBDV at 21 days of age produced near normal antibody responses as compared with the responses in noninfected control chicks. The IBDV had no significant effect on the thymus-dependent cellular responses as measured by skin graft rejection or delayed type hypersensitivity reactions to tuberculin.  相似文献

The immune response of pigs fed 200 mg per day of dinitrophenylated bovine gamma globulin has been evaluated in terms of the antibody and lymphocyte responses and of the induction of tolerance and immune exclusion. Although dosing for ten days resulted in a small IgA response as indicated by splenic plaque forming cells, serum antibody could only be detected when dosing was continued for 42 days. secretory antibody was detected at any time. Antigen feeding for two weeks rendered the animals hyporesponsive to subsequent parenteral antigenic challenge but had little effect upon their ability to exclude an oral dose of antigen from the circulation.  相似文献

Adult ponies which were fed ovalbumin (OVA) daily for 2 weeks had significantly greater serum anti-OVA IgG (P = 0.001) and antigen specific lymphocyte responses (P = 0.031) after intramuscular injection with OVA given with saponin than control ponies which had not been fed the antigen. This suggests that, despite the lack of evidence of B- or T-cell activation in peripheral blood during the period of OVA feeding, the animals were primed for an active secondary immune response. Adult ponies were challenged with equine rotavirus, strain H-2, but no statistically significant differences were found in serum IgG-associated antibody responses or antigen-specific lymphocyte responses between the rotavirus-challenged group and the control group, either following rotavirus challenge or intramuscular injection of rotavirus antigen given with saponin. Our findings, that feeding the non-replicating protein antigen OVA appeared to prime for an increased immune response rather than inducing oral tolerance, may be of relevance to future studies on the way the equine gastrointestinal tract handles usually harmless antigens.  相似文献

Three sheep were fed a pelleted high-roughage diet either once, 6, or 24 times per day in a 3 x 3 Latin square trial. During each 21-d period, 14 d were allowed for adaptation followed by a 7-d collection period, in which samples for microbial counts were taken on d 1 and 5 and several rumen parameters were measured on d 2 and 6. Bacterial concentrations were not different between feeding frequencies on the first sampling day but were higher (P < 0.05) on the second sampling day when the sheep were fed 24 times a day. Fungal concentrations were not different among feeding frequencies on either sampling day. No effects of feeding frequency were observed for the concentration of cellulolytic bacteria or fungi. On d 2, ruminal volume was larger (P < 0.05) with six feedings than with one feeding and fluid volume turnover was greater (P < 0.05) when sheep were fed 24 times per day. Rumen pH values were higher (P < 0.01) on both d 1 and 5 when the sheep were fed once a day and the percentage of rumen dry matter was highest (P < 0.02) with 24 feedings. These findings would suggest that if the same amount of a given diet is fed daily, the number of feedings does not markedly affect microbial concentrations, rumen volume, or liquid turnover time.  相似文献

左旋咪唑对鸡细胞免疫和体液免疫功能的作用   总被引:38,自引:2,他引:38  
系统研究了左旋咪唑对鸡细胞免疫和体液免疫功能的作用。结果表明左旋咪唑可影响正常鸡的免疫功能 :左旋咪唑可显著促进鸡外周血T淋巴细胞增殖 ,但对B淋巴细胞无明显影响 :2 5~ 1 0mg/kg左旋咪唑可使CD+4/CD+8淋巴细胞比值明显升高 ;左旋咪唑可使鸡体内抗颗粒性、胸腺依赖性抗原SRBC抗体滴度 ,抗可溶性、胸腺依赖性抗原BSA抗体滴度和抗非胸腺依赖性抗原BA抗体滴度均明显升高 ;2 5~ 1 0mg/kg左旋咪唑可使鸡血清总补体活性明显升高。左旋咪唑影响正常鸡回忆性免疫应答反应 :左旋咪唑 ( 1 0mg/kg)可使二次免疫鸡抗SRBC抗体滴度和抗BA抗体滴度回忆性免疫应答反应明显升高 ;但使鸡对抗BSA抗体滴度回忆性免疫应答反应明显降低。  相似文献

Our group has established two lines of meat-type chickens divergently selected for early (HC line) and late (LC line) antibody responsiveness at 10 days of age to immunization with inactivated pathogenic Escherichia coli bacteria. The question addressed in the study presented here is whether this selection has changed other immunological responses, increasing the overall 'early' immunocompetence. Broilers of the third and fourth generations (S3 and S4) of the selected lines (HC and LC) and a control, unselected line (CT) were vaccinated at 10 days of age with E. coli vaccine, Newcastle virus vaccine (NDV), sheep erythrocytes (SRBC) or bovine serum albumin (BSA). Line-HC chicks exhibited higher antibody titers to E. coli, NDV and SRBC than CT or LC chicks. At 20 days of age HC chicks demonstrated a higher total protein and a higher beta- and gamma-globulin levels in their serum. At 21 days of age, HC chicks cleared carbon particles faster than LC chicks. Peripheral blood lymphocytes (PBL) from HC chicks vaccinated with E. coli vaccine, proliferated in vitro more actively in the presence of the stimulating antigen than the PBL of LC chicks. Peripheral blood lymphocytes (PBL) obtained from HC-line chicks exhibited a higher proliferative response to concanavalin A (Con A)-, phytohemagglutinin (PHA)- or pokeweed mitogen (PWM)-stimulation than LC PBL. These results demonstrate that the selection for high or low antibody response to E. coli at a young age resulted also in a significant change in the response of other parameters of the immune system. The high response to E. coli was found to be associated with a high antibody response to other antigens (NDV and SRBC), increased phagocytic activity and increased proliferative response to antigen or mitogens. The selection most probably affected early immunocompetence.  相似文献

OBJECTIVE: To determine whether oral administration of ursodeoxycholic acid (UDCA) to healthy dogs alters the results of the bile acids tolerance test. METHODS: UDCA (15 mg/kg once daily) was administered to 16 healthy dogs for 7 days. Health of the dogs was assessed by clinical examination, haematology, serum biochemistry and a bile acids tolerance test. Normal liver structure was confirmed by histopathology at the end of the study. Bile acids tolerance tests were performed before and at the end of the treatment period, with each dog serving as its own control. For the posttreatment bile acids tolerance test, UDCA was administered at the time of feeding. RESULTS: Pretreatment, the fasted serum total bile acid concentrations ranged between 0 and 9 micromol/L. In the majority of dogs, the postprandial total bile acid concentration was greater than the preprandial value, with a range of 0 to 16 micromol/L. The fasted total bile acid concentration was 0 micromol/L in most dogs (93.75%) after treatment with UDCA. Postprandial serum bile acids also remained within the reference range for the majority of dogs (93.75%) after UDCA treatment. A single dog had a postprandial bile acid concentration above the reference range, but the concentration was within the reference range when the assay was repeated the following day without concurrent administration of UDCA. The pre- and postprandial total serum bile acid concentrations were not significantly affected by UDCA treatment. CONCLUSION: The administration of UDCA does not alter the bile acids tolerance test of normal healthy dogs.  相似文献

The individual and combined effects of feeding fumonisin B1 (FB1; 0, 100, 200 mg FB1/kg) and moniliformin (M; 0, 100, 200 mg M/kg) were evaluated using a 3 x 3 factorial arrangement of treatments. Significant mortality (P < 0.05) occurred in chicks fed all diets containing 200 mg M/kg (50%-65%). Compared with controls and chicks fed FB1, both feed intake and body weight gain were decreased (P < 0.05) in chicks fed diets containing 100 mg M/kg. Chicks fed M had heavier heart weights (P < 0.05) than control chicks or chicks fed FB1. Compared with controls, chicks fed diets containing 200 mg M/kg or a combination of 200 mg FB1/kg and 100 mg M/kg had increased kidney and liver weights (P < 0.05). Significant FB1 by M interactions (P < 0.05) were observed for serum total protein and aspartate aminotransferase. Mild to moderate periportal extramedullary hematopoiesis and mild focal hepatic necrosis were observed in chicks fed FB1 alone. An increased incidence of large pleomorphic cardiomyocyte nuclei, loss of cardiomyocytes, and mild focal renal tubular mineralization were observed in chicks fed M alone. Both cardiac and renal lesions were observed in chicks fed combinations of FB1 and M. Data indicate FB1 and M, alone or in combination, can adversely affect chick performance and health at these dietary concentrations. The interactive effects of FB1 and M were not synergistic and were less than additive in nature. At the dietary concentrations studied, M is much more toxic to broilers than FB1.  相似文献

Pigs weaned at three weeks old absorb food protein antigens from the intestine. The amount of antigen absorbed declines over the next three weeks, and this decline is associated with an increasing level of serum antibody to the fed proteins. There was no difference in the rate of immune elimination of intravenously injected antigen in fed and unfed controls. The reduction of serum antigen is thus likely to reflect reduced absorption, possibly mediated by locally produced antibody. Pigs weaned at 10 weeks old also absorbed antigens and produced an antibody response when introduced to soya; and after three weeks of feeding soya the absorption of antigen was substantially reduced. This latter exclusion was specific for soya as a second novel protein (ovalbumin) was absorbed when introduced to the diet at this time. At six months, pigs no longer absorbed soya proteins when they were introduced to the diet. Furthermore, pigs of this age had serum 'antibody' to soya and other proteins such as keyhole limpet haemocyanin to which they had never been exposed.  相似文献

Virginiamycin (Stafac 20) was mixed with feed at three levels recommended for chickens--5.5, 11, and 22 mg/kg (respectively 5, 10 and 20 g/ton)--and fed to broiler chicks. When fed from 1 day through 2 weeks of age, the drug appeared to retard infection of the lower small intestine by long, segmented, filamentous organisms (LSFOs), and at 2 weeks of age serum carotenoids in treated chicks were significantly higher than levels found in unmedicated chicks. However, as chicks were grown out to 4 and 6 weeks of age, the drug did not completely prevent eventual LSFO infection, even at the highest dose, and mean serum carotenoid levels in treated chicks were not significantly different from levels in control chicks. However, chicks fed at the level of 22 mg/kg had fewer LSFOs. Withdrawal of virginiamycin from treated chicks at 4 weeks of age allowed LSFO infection to occur but did not significantly affect serum carotenoid levels. When the drug was fed for 2 weeks at 22 mg/kg to 2-week-old chicks already infected with LSFOs, the bacteria could no longer be detected, suggesting that virginiamycin may aid the natural decline in LSFO population. Coincident with this treatment, serum carotenoids were higher, but not significantly so. Virginiamycin did not significantly increase the mean body weights of chicks in any of these experiments.  相似文献

1. Immunoresponsiveness and disease resistance were measured in broiler males maintained on ad libitum feeding throughout or on alternate‐day feeding. Alternate‐day restrictions were started 1 and 2 d after hatch so that on any one day there were chicks fed and fasted.

2. Severity of response to E. coli challenge as measured by lesion scores, and mortality was greater for chicks fed ad libitum than those fed on alternate days. For chicks fed on alternate days, lesion scores were lower for those without access to feed for the 24‐h period immediately after challenge.

3. Spleen weights, the indicator of response to marble spleen disease virus challenge, were higher for chicks fed ad libitum than those fed on alternate days.

4. Antibody response to sheep red blood cell antigen was not affected by feeding regimen.

5. Ratios of heterophils to lymphocytes were higher for chicks given access to feed for the previous 24‐h period than for those fasted during the previous 24‐h or those that had been fed ad libitum.

6. Results of this experiment suggest that for alternate‐day feeding programs, vaccination be administered on the day that chicks are not fed.  相似文献

Antibody titers for infectious bursal disease virus (IBDV), infectious bronchitis virus, Newcastle disease virus, and reovirus from chicks with chicken anemia agent (CAA) antibodies were compared with antibody titers from their CAA-antibody-negative counterparts. These comparisons were made in 396 chickens that were 1 day, 2 weeks, 8-9 weeks, 10 weeks, 17 weeks, or 29-32 weeks old. Only one serum sample was collected from any given chick or chicken. There were no significant differences between the antibody titers at any age for any antigen, with one exception: at 29-32 weeks, the IBDV titers were higher (t = 2.62, df = 142, P less than 0.01) in chickens with CAA antibody. Although not at all likely, we believe that the observation of high IBDV antibody titers in CAA-antibody-positive chicks could have been a spurious one.  相似文献

The potential for improving the nutritive value of commercial solvent-extracted, heat-treated soya-bean meal (SBM) by protease treatment was measured using growing broiler chicks and tube-fed broiler cockerels. 2. SBM was pre-treated (50 degrees C for 2 h) with water alone; at alkaline pH (initial pH 8.25) with and without protease P1 (isolated from a Bacillus species) or at acid pH (initial pH 4.5) with and without protease P2 (isolated from an Aspergillus species) and incorporated into diets (290 g SBM/kg diet) for broiler chicks (20 chicks/treatment). Only protease P2 treatment improved chick performance; from 7 to 28 d of age, chicks fed on treated SBM had greater feed intakes and gained more weight than chicks fed on untreated SBM. Both proteases P1 and P2 significantly reduced chick serum anti-soya antibodies while protease P2 treatment increased apparent ileal nitrogen (N) digestibility and apparent N retention across the whole digestive tract. 3. Two tube-feeding experiments established that, of the treated SBMs used in experiment 1, only protease P2 treatment improved apparent N digestibility and true metabolisable energy. Also it was shown that increasing the temperature at which treated SBM was dried to 60 degrees C, compared with freeze-drying or drying at 50 degrees C reduced apparent N digestibility and true metabolisable energy of SBM with no significant interactions between enzyme treatment and drying temperature for both apparent N digestibility and TME. 4. It is concluded that, overall, the nutritional value of SBM assayed in a growth trial and by tube feeding was improved by treatment with protease P2 and not by treatment with protease P1.  相似文献

1. Two-week-old male chicks of a light-bodied strain were fed one (1M) or two (2M) 2-h meals per day. An additional group was pair-fed (P1M) the amount consumed by the 1M group on the previous day. 2. After 21 days, final body weight of the 1M and 2M chicks attained 65% and 80%, respectively, of that of the control group fed ad libitum. The weight gain of the P1M chicks was equal to that of the 1M chicks. 3. Food consumption of chicks adapted to meals was not even throughout the feeding period. On day 16 of the experiment, the 1M birds consumed 65% of the meal during the first 30 min. P1M chicks behaved similarly to the 1M ones. The intake of the 2M chicks during each meal was exactly half of their daily consumption, despite the uneven time period between meals. 4. The time during which food remained in the gastrointestinal tract (GIT) was longer under the meal feeding regimes than in the ad libitum-fed groups. 5. Although neither body composition nor metabolisable energy was affected by meal regime, food utilisation was poorer in the 1M and P1M than in the ad libitum and 2M-fed chicks.  相似文献

A feeding trial was conducted for 60 days to delineate the effect of alternate day feeding strategy of sub‐optimal protein level on haematological parameters, serum parameters and phagocyte respiratory burst activity (NBT) in Labeo rohita juveniles. One hundred and thirty‐five fingerlings (1.87 ± 0.01–2.26 ± 0.05 g) were distributed in triplicate groups of each treatment, and fish were fed at 5% body weight daily. Three experimental isocaloric (401.32–410.28 kcal/100 g) diets of 30%, 25%, and 20% crude protein designated as diet A, diet B, and diet C respectively, were prepared, using locally available feed ingredients. Three different feeding schedules of normal protein diet continuously (diet A‐30%), alternate feeding of 1‐day diet A followed by 1‐day diet B (1A/1B) and alternate feeding of 1‐day diet A followed by 1‐day diet C (1A/1C) were tested. The total erythrocyte count and haemoglobin content was significantly (p < 0.05) enhanced in the group T1 fed (1A/1B), and the lowest count was recorded in the group T2 fed (1A/1C). Total leucocyte counts, total serum protein, and serum globulin were higher in the group T1 fed (1A/1B) and lower in the group T2 fed (1A/1C) as compare to control. The respiratory burst activity (NBT) of blood phagocytes and serum A‐to‐G ratio was recorded significantly difference in among the treatment groups. Based on the results of the present study, it is concluded that alternate feeding of 1‐day diet A followed by 1‐day diet B (1A/1B) is equally effective and promote the immunity in Labeo rohita juveniles.  相似文献

A study was conducted to evaluate the effects of ochratoxin A (OA) on Escherichia coli-challenged broiler chickens. Day-old broiler chicks were separated into two groups of 92 chicks each, with one group fed a control mash diet, and the other fed a mash diet containing 2 ppm OA. On day 14, each group was further separated into two groups, with one group inoculated with E. coli O78 (1 x 10(7) colony-forming units/0.5 ml), whereas the other group was not inoculated with E. coli. After E. coli inoculation on day 14, four birds from each group were euthanatized at 1, 2, 3, 5, 7, 10, 14, and 21 days postinoculation. Escherichia coli infection caused dullness, depression, huddling, and diarrhea. Mortality was 14.3% in chicks infected with E. coli but fed no OA. Mortality increased to 35.7% in chicks fed OA and infected with E. coli. Decreased body weight and reduced feed intake were observed in chicks fed OA, and the effects were more pronounced in chicks fed OA and infected with E. coli. Increased serum levels of aspartate aminotransferase, alanine aminotransferase, uric acid, and creatinine and decreased levels of total proteins, albumin, globulins, calcium, and phosphorus were observed in OA-fed birds. Escherichia coli infection did not cause significant alteration in any of the serum biochemical parameters. The presence of OA in poultry rations increased mortality and the severity of an E. coli infection.  相似文献

This study was conducted to determine the effect of early-age food restriction on heat shock protein (hsp) 70 synthesis in the brains of female broiler chickens exposed to high ambient temperatures. 2. Chicks were brooded for 3 weeks and then maintained at 24+/-1 degrees C. 3. On d 0, chicks were assigned to one of 4 feeding regimens; each regimen was applied to 4 cages of chicks. The regimens were: (1) ad libitum feeding (AL); (2) 80% food restriction at 4, 5 and 6 d of age (F80); (3) 60% food restriction at 4, 5, and 6 d of age (F60); and (4) 40% food restriction at 4, 5 and 6 d of age (F40). From d 35 to d 41, all chicks were subjected to 38+/-1 degrees C for 2 h/d. 4. One day following food restriction (d 7), hsp 70 expression in the brain samples of F60 and F40 chicks was augmented but not those fed AL and F80. 5. Prior to the heat challenge (d 35), all chicks had similar hsp 70 response. Irrespective of feeding regimen, there was a marked increase in hsp 70 expression after 4 d of heat treatment (d 38). Following 7 d of heat exposure (d 41), except for the F60 chicks, the augmented hsp 70 expression in the brains of AL, F80 and F40 birds was not maintained. 6. Enhancement of hsp 70 expression was noted in birds subjected to F60, but not AL, F80 or F40, throughout the period of heat exposure.  相似文献

The purpose of the present study was to demonstrate that nuclear medicine technology allows observation of the effect that milk clotting has on abomasal emptying in the living neonatal calf. Scintigraphic evaluation of abomasal emptying was carried out in 6 healthy male Holstein calves. The calves were fed 10% of their body weight daily as whole cow's milk that was divided equally and consumed as 2 feedings via a nipple bottle. One day before the nuclear scintigraphic procedure, the calves were randomly fed whole cow's milk, or an oral rehydration solution (ORS) containing bicarbonate and high levels of soluble fibre was fed for 3 consecutive feedings an hour before the portion of milk. For each calf, both feeding programs were repeated twice at a one-week interval. Immediately following administration of the 99mTC-sulfur-colloid-containing milk, the calves were imaged with the gamma camera positioned lateral and ventral to the abomasum. Additional right lateral and ventral views of the abomasum were collected at 15, 30, 45, 60, 90, 120, 150, 180, 210, and 240 min after administration of the radionuclide. Blood glucose determination were performed at one-hour intervals for 7 h after feeding milk to evaluate milk digestibility in both feeding programs. No significant differences in the results of the glucose absorption test or in the radionuclide counts of the abomasum were found between both feeding programs. Scintigraphic evaluation of abomasal emptying was found to be a useful technique for visualization of milk clotting and to test the effect of an ORS on milk digestibility.  相似文献

This study was carried out to evaluate the nutritional effects of rice feeding and carnitine addition to a diet for broiler chicks. Thirty‐six male 10‐day‐old broiler chicks were assigned to one of the following four treatment groups: corn‐based diet (corn group), rice‐based diet (rice group), and each diet with added carnitine (100 ppm). The experimental period was 2 weeks. Rice feeding resulted in significantly higher growth performance (body weight gain and feed efficiency) compared to corn feeding. Carnitine addition also resulted in higher growth performance. Breast muscle and thigh muscle weight (g) were significantly higher in broiler chicks fed rice and those fed diets with added carnitine. Liver mRNA expression of IGF‐I was significantly higher in broiler chicks fed rice compared to those fed corn. There was no significant difference in mRNA expression of muscle atrogin‐1 or liver CPT‐I between broiler chicks fed rice and those fed corn, not between broilers chicks fed diets containing carnitine or not. Overall, these results show that rice feeding and carnitine addition improve the growth performance of broiler chicks by increasing mRNA expression of liver IGF‐I. In addition, carnitine action is not affected by different cereals (corn and rice).  相似文献
